However, it can have strong currents, especially on larger swell days. While specific lifeguard presence can vary by season, it's common for lifeguards to be present during peak summer months. Always check local signage for current safety information, be aware of rip tides, and consider your abilities, particularly if surfing.","q":"Is Gwynver Beach safe for swimming and surfing, and are lifeguards present?"},{"a":"For surfing, Gwynver Beach can be good year-round, depending on swell conditions. To avoid crowds, especially during good weather, visiting outside of peak summer months (July-August) is recommended. Early mornings or late afternoons on weekdays also offer a quieter experience. Its slightly more 'hidden' nature means it's often less busy than the main Sennen Cove, providing a more serene visit.","q":"When is the best time to visit Gwynver Beach for surfing or to avoid crowds?"},{"a":"Gwynver Beach is located north of Sennen Cove. Access typically involves parking at a nearby car park (often a field car park during peak season) and then a walk down a fairly steep path to the beach. The path can be uneven, so suitable footwear is essential. It's less directly accessible than Sennen Cove, contributing to its quieter atmosphere. Public transport to Sennen is available, but reaching Gwynver requires further walking.","q":"How do I get to Gwynver Beach, and is there parking available?"},{"a":"Gwynver Beach itself is quite wild and undeveloped, so there are no direct food or lodging facilities on the beach. However, the nearby village of Sennen Cove offers a selection of cafes, a pub, and shops where you can find refreshments and meals. For accommodation, Sennen and the surrounding area have guesthouses, B&Bs, and self-catering options. It's best to plan for food and drink before heading to Gwynver.","q":"What food and lodging options are available near Gwynver Beach?"},{"a":"Gwynver Beach is considered a 'wilder' alternative to Sennen Cove due to its more secluded location and less developed surroundings.
